Ultimate Gooey Cinnamon Roll Casserole

gooey cinnamon roll casserole - featured image

A warm, gooey cinnamon roll casserole that combines the sticky sweetness and soft dough of cinnamon rolls into one easy, crowd-pleasing breakfast dish.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 package (8 count) refrigerated cinnamon rolls with icing (e.g., Pillsbury)
  • 3 large eggs, room temperature
  • 1 cup (240 ml) whole milk or 2%
  • ½ cup packed br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on ground cinnamon
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 4 oz (113 g) c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 2 tablespoons butter, melted
  • A pinch of sal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Lightly grease a 9×13 inch baking dish with butter or non-stick spray.
  2. Slice the cinnamon rolls into 1-inch thick pieces, separating if stuck together.
  3. Arrange half of the cinnamon roll slices in a single layer at the bottom of the baking dish.
  4. In a medium bowl, whisk together eggs, milk, brown sugar, cinnamon, vanilla extract, melted butter, and salt until smooth.
  5. Pour half of the egg mixture evenly over the cinnamon rolls in the pan, gently nudging the rolls to soak up the liquid.
  6. Add the remaining cinnamon roll slices over the soaked layer, then pour the rest of the egg mixture on top.
  7. Bake uncovered for 30-35 minutes until golden brown on edges and a toothpick inserted comes out mostly clean but moist.
  8. While baking, prepare the glaze by beating softened cream cheese until smooth, gradually adding powdered sugar and a splash of vanilla extract until creamy. Add a teaspoon of milk if too thick.
  9. Remove casserole from oven and let cool for 10 minutes.
  10. Drizzle the cream cheese glaze liberally over the warm casserole and serve warm.

Notes

Do not overbake to keep the casserole gooey; tent with foil if top browns too fast. Let casserole rest after baking for best texture. For extra gooeyness, add dollops of cream cheese between cinnamon roll layers before pouring batter. Can prepare the night before and bake fresh in the morning, adding a few extra minutes to baking time.
